7 Tips for Conducting a Successful Penetration Testing Engagement

7 Tips for Conducting a Successful Penetration Testing Engagement

26th
Apr

The emergence of digital transformation has made cybersecurity a crucial concern for businesses across various sectors and sizes. With the increase in cyber-attacks, there is a growing demand for cybersecurity professionals who can safeguard the confidentiality, integrity, and availability of digital assets. To meet this demand, CompTIA Security+ certification has emerged as a vital credential that validates the knowledge and skills of cybersecurity experts. It covers a broad range of topics, including threat management, network security, identity management, cryptography, and risk management. This certification is vendor-neutral, indicating that it is not linked to any specific technology or platform. This makes it widely recognized and accepted globally as a reliable validation of a cybersecurity professional's expertise.

In this article, we'll go through the top seven recommendations for performing a successful penetration testing engagement, ensuring your organization's security is strong and safe from threats.

  • ➤ Tip 1: Define Objectives and Scope

The objectives and scope of the penetration testing engagement must be defined for it to be successful. It is critical to explicitly define the testing's aims and expectations. This will assist in ensuring that the testing team understands the purpose of the testing as well as what is expected of them. The testing scope should be well-defined, taking into account the systems or networks to be tested, the testing timeframes, and the types of vulnerabilities to be checked.

It is also critical to examine any regulatory or compliance requirements that may have an impact on the scope of the testing. By having a clear understanding of the objectives and scope of the testing, the organisation can guarantee that the testing is aligned with its business objectives and that the testing is executed efficiently and effectively.

  • ➤ Tip 2: Identify Risks and Vulnerabilities

Conducting a complete risk assessment is crucial for identifying potential security flaws in a system or network that cyber attackers can exploit. The penetration testing team must examine the target organization's security posture in order to uncover all possible entry points that attackers could employ to infiltrate the system. 

This includes detecting vulnerabilities in the system's software and hardware, as well as human aspects such as weak passwords or social engineering tactics. The team can build a tailored strategy for penetration testing that simulates real-world attack scenarios and delivers a more realistic evaluation of the organization's security posture by prioritising the most significant areas of weakness.

  • ➤ Tip 3: Select the Right Testing Methodology

Choosing the right testing technique is critical for a successful penetration testing engagement. The many testing approaches, such as black-box, white-box, and grey-box testing, each have their own set of advantages and disadvantages. As a result, the testing technique should be chosen based on the objectives and scope of the testing, as well as the risks and vulnerabilities found during the risk assessment. 

Black-box testing is useful for examining an organization's external security posture, whereas white-box testing is more appropriate for assessing its internal security posture. Grey-box testing provides a middle ground between the two techniques and can be effective in detecting vulnerabilities that black-box or white-box testing alone may miss.

  • ➤ Tip 4: Prepare and Train the Testing Team

To guarantee a successful penetration testing engagement, it is critical to thoroughly prepare and train the testing team. The testing methodology and technologies used during the testing process should be thoroughly understood by the team. This understanding enables them to efficiently detect vulnerabilities and make remedial recommendations. 

Furthermore, the team should be trained to collaborate and communicate effectively with one another and with the client's stakeholders. Effective communication ensures that the testing process is efficient and that any detected vulnerabilities are reported to the client as soon as possible. Finally, a well-prepared and trained testing team is essential for executing a comprehensive and effective penetration testing engagement.

  • ➤ Tip 5: Conduct the Testing in a Safe Manner

It is vital to take safety precautions when undertaking penetration testing to avoid inadvertent damage to the system or network under scrutiny. The testing team should proceed with caution and be prepared to halt testing immediately if any unforeseen issues arise. It is also vital to protect sensitive data while adhering to all current rules and regulations. 

The team should create a comprehensive plan that specifies the scope of the test, the objectives, and the potential risks connected with the engagement. A safe and secure testing environment ensures that the testing process operates smoothly and achieves its intended goals without causing any harm to the system or network.

  • ➤ Tip 6: Document and Report Findings

Documentation and reporting are essential components of every effective penetration testing campaign. It entails meticulously recording the testing process, including the methodology and tools used, as well as the vulnerabilities discovered. Effective documentation and reporting can provide significant insights into an organization's security posture, enabling informed decision-making and targeted remedial activities. 

Clear and simple reporting is required, identifying the most severe risks and providing practical advice for mitigating them. By carefully documenting and reporting results, the client may make educated judgements about their security posture and take the necessary changes to enhance it.

  • ➤ Tip 7: Follow Up on Remediation

Following the identification and reporting of vulnerabilities, it is critical to design a plan for remediation and follow-up to ensure that the vulnerabilities are addressed. This is the final and possibly most critical tip for completing a successful penetration testing engagement. In order to address the identified vulnerabilities, remediation plans should be developed in consultation with stakeholders. 

Regular communication and reporting on the status of repair efforts will assist in making the system or network more secure and less vulnerable to intrusions. Furthermore, follow-up testing may be required to ensure that the remedial measures were effective in resolving the vulnerabilities.

Conclusion

To summarise, an effective penetration testing engagement involves careful planning and execution. Following the aforementioned criteria, organisations can do effective penetration testing, discovering vulnerabilities and lowering the chance of cyberattacks. Furthermore, earning penetration testing certification training provides workers with the knowledge and abilities required to execute successful penetration testing engagements and strengthen the cybersecurity architecture of their organisation.



Message From the Author

If you’re looking to enrol in Cyber security courses in UAE, get in touch with Learners Point Academy. To learn more, visit the website: https://learnerspoint.org/, give a call at +971 (04) 403 8000, or simply drop a message on WhatsApp.

Learners Point Academy is a KHDA and ISO 9001:2015 accredited training institute in Dubai.

  • Big Data on AWS
  • Cyber Security

Leave a reply

Your email address will not be published.

text